China Launches Largest IPv6 Network
Tuesday December 28, 2004
| Commentary | The People's Republic of China has successfully deployed the first pure production IPv6 network. Besides supporting the 128-bit IP addressing model of the future, this network also boasts extremely high speeds ranging from 2.5 Gb/s up to 40 Gb/s. It's little surprise this advance happened in PRC, where the shortage of IPv4 address space is felt much more acutely than in the USA.
